Participation inside a Dhol Tasha Pathak (group) is becoming a well-liked avenue for anyone desperate to be a component of this cultural phenomenon. Folks irrespective of age, gender and degree of musicianship Obtain in the course of the monsoons to exercise and rehearse Together with the group that will be ‘employed’ by several Mandals (geography dependent groups) to steer their Ganesh idol for welcome or immersion. It's not a for-profit activity nevertheless the money raised through the Neighborhood with the Mandals help these Pathaks address their prices of venue retain the services of for rehearsals, drum obtain and maintenance etc… Pune, currently being a cultural hub, boasts various Dhol Tasha Pathaks, Just about every with its exclusive design and id.

The dhol is often a double-sided barrel drum played largely as an accompanying instrument in regional music kinds. In Qawwali music, the expression dhol is applied to explain the same, but smaller drum with a scaled-down tabla, as being a alternative for your still left-hand tabla drum. The typical measurements of your drum fluctuate a little bit from area to location. In Punjab, the dhol continues to be massive and ponderous to make the preferred loud bass. In other locations, dhols are available in varying sizes and styles, and designed with distinct woods and products (fiberglass, steel, plastic).

Up to date tassa drums are created by slicing an empty coolant tank or buoy in 50 percent and attaching a synthetic drum pores and skin to the top of it with nuts and bolts, welding it shut. Artificial drums do last extended and don't have to get adjusted as commonly. Even though artificial drums last extended, they deviate in the very long-standing tradition of clay and goatskin and, As outlined by some connoisseurs and aficionados, do not audio as well on account of its limited array of pitch and chilly, metallic, twangy tones.
